--- MITgcm_contrib/ESMF/global_ocean.128x64x15/build.sh 2004/03/29 16:18:09 1.10 +++ MITgcm_contrib/ESMF/global_ocean.128x64x15/build.sh 2004/03/30 03:48:34 1.12 @@ -4,8 +4,8 @@ # setenv BUILDROOT `pwd` #setenv COMP_PROF GFDL_HPCS -setenv COMP_PROF blackforest_withcam -#setenv COMP_PROF faulks +#setenv COMP_PROF blackforest_withcam +setenv COMP_PROF faulks source mytools/comp_profile.BASE source mytools/comp_profile.${COMP_PROF} setenv TCSH_PATH `which tcsh` @@ -18,17 +18,17 @@ # # Build MITgcm OCN computational code setenv pesizelist_top "1 2 4 8 16 32" -setenv pesizelist_top "16" +setenv pesizelist_top "2" foreach pe ( $pesizelist_top ) setenv pesizelist $pe -###./build_mitgcm_org_ocn.sh -###cd ${BUILDROOT} +./build_mitgcm_org_ocn.sh +cd ${BUILDROOT} # # Build combined CAM stub computational and ESMF component interface layer -###cd esmf_top/cam_stub -###./comp1.sh -###cd ${BUILDROOT} +cd esmf_top/cam_stub +./comp1.sh +cd ${BUILDROOT} # # Build internal component interface layer for the MITgcm OCN ESMF component @@ -44,19 +44,19 @@ # # Build combined CAM stub computational and ESMF component interface layer -###cd esmf_top/mitgcm_ocn2cam -###./comp1.sh -###cd ${BUILDROOT} +cd esmf_top/mitgcm_ocn2cam +./comp1.sh +cd ${BUILDROOT} # # Build the composition layer and executable for the ocean only ESMF application -###cd esmf_top/ocn_only_app -###./comp2.sh -###cd ${BUILDROOT} +cd esmf_top/ocn_only_app +./comp2.sh +cd ${BUILDROOT} # # Build the composition layer and executable for the ocean+CAM ESMF application -###cd esmf_top/cam_stub-mitgcm_ocn_app -###./comp2.sh -###cd ${BUILDROOT} +cd esmf_top/cam_stub-mitgcm_ocn_app +./comp2.sh +cd ${BUILDROOT} end